    A freehold investment including 54 apartments and 3 let retail units. This 19th Century Grade II Listed Brewery renovation and conversion is a prominent local landmark, and a highly successful development. The retails units on comparatively long leases, produce a gross income of £54,000 per annum. Service charge income for year end June 2024 in the audited management accounts totals £88,473. The leasehold interest on a term of 125 years generally from around 2010. Ground rent, currently total £tbc p.a.

    The building stands with a prominent frontage to Northgate adjacent to the Retail Park. This building is within two or three minutes walking distance of Newark Northgate Railway Station with regular services to London King's Cross and journey times in just over 75 minutes.

    Newark on Trent has a population of approximately 35,000, and a catchment area of a further 150,000 approximately. Newark has a growth point designation and the current economy is buoyant. There is a massive expansion of housing. Trading in the town as a result is thriving and as a shopping centre Newark is an increasingly popular place to visit.

    The investment provides a substantial ground rent/service charge and retail investment income.
